*ISLAMABAD – Pakistan Supreme Court has declared Pak-Turk International CagEducation Foundation (PTICEF) as ‘proscribed organization’.*
The three-judge bench headed by Chief Justice of Pakistan (CJP) Mian SaqibNisar and comprising Justice Faisal Arab and Justice Ijazul Ahsan hasissued a 15-page verdict, on a petition, to declare PTCIF as terroristorganization.
The court while directing the ministry of interior to declare PTICEF asbanned organization, had ordered to include its name in the ‘First Scheduleto section 11-B of the Anti-Terrorism Act 1997’.
“We are in no manner of doubt the government of Pakistan has internationalobligations towards the government of Turkey to declare Fethullah’sTerrorist Organization (FETO) as a terrorist organization”, reads theverdict.
The order further says these represent international commitment of thegovernment of Pakistan towards the international community and moreimportantly towards the Repulic of Turkey with which the government andpeople of Pakistan enjoy close and highly cordial, fraternal and brotherlyrelations spanning over centuries.
The court in its written verdict said all movable and immovable assets ofPTCEF and its schools colleges, tuition centers and other similar entitiesshall stand vested in TMF with immediate effect.
